A web based serial monitor for communicating with serial devices (like Arduino). The library is based on native web components and uses the WebSerial API to communicate with the external device.

/**
* @author Tom Neutens <tomneutens@gmail.com>
*/
import {msg} from "@lit/localize"
import InvalidArugmentError from "../errors/InvalidArgumentError"
enum SerialMonitorSetting {
DISPLAY_TYPE = "displayType",
DATA_TYPE = "dataType",
BAUD_RATE = "baudRate",
VIEW = "outputView"
}
enum DisplayTypeSetting {
DEC = "dec",
BIN = "bin",
OCT = "oct",
HEX = "hex"
}
enum DataTypeSetting {
BYTE = "byte",
STRING = "string"
}
enum BaudRateSetting {
RATE_300 = "300",
RATE_600 = "600",
RATE_1200 = "1200",
RATE_2400 = "2400",
RATE_4800 = "4800",
RATE_9600 = "9600",
RATE_14400 = "14400",
RATE_19200 = "19200",
RATE_28800 = "28800",
RATE_38400 = "38400",
RATE_57600 = "57600",
RATE_115200 = "115200",
}
enum ViewSetting {
RAW = "raw",
PLOT = "plot"
}
type SettingsList<T extends string> = {labelText: string, labelValue: T}[]
class SerialMonitorConfig {
displayType: SettingsList<DisplayTypeSetting> = [
{labelText: msg("dec"), labelValue: DisplayTypeSetting.DEC},
{labelText: msg("bin"), labelValue: DisplayTypeSetting.BIN},
{labelText: msg("oct"), labelValue: DisplayTypeSetting.OCT},
{labelText: msg("hex"), labelValue: DisplayTypeSetting.HEX}
]
dataType: SettingsList<DataTypeSetting> = [
{labelText: msg("string"), labelValue: DataTypeSetting.STRING},
{labelText: msg("byte"), labelValue: DataTypeSetting.BYTE},
]
private rates = Object.values(BaudRateSetting)
baudRate: SettingsList<BaudRateSetting> = new Array<{labelText:string, labelValue:BaudRateSetting}> // init in constructor since no translations
outputView: SettingsList<ViewSetting> = [
{labelText: msg("raw"), labelValue: ViewSetting.RAW},
{labelText: msg("plot"), labelValue: ViewSetting.PLOT},
]
private settingsOptions: Record<SerialMonitorSetting, SettingsList<string>> = {
[SerialMonitorSetting.DISPLAY_TYPE]: this.displayType,
[SerialMonitorSetting.DATA_TYPE]: this.dataType,
[SerialMonitorSetting.BAUD_RATE]: this.baudRate,
[SerialMonitorSetting.VIEW]: this.outputView
}
selectionIndex: {[index: string]: number} = {displayType: 0, dataType: 0, baudRate: 5, outputView: 0}
serialPortFilters: SerialPortFilter[] = [];
constructor(){
this.rates.forEach(element => {
this.baudRate.push({"labelText": element, "labelValue": element})
});
}
getDisplayType(): DisplayTypeSetting{
return this.displayType[this.selectionIndex[SerialMonitorSetting.DISPLAY_TYPE]].labelValue;
}
getDataType(): DataTypeSetting{
return this.dataType[this.selectionIndex[SerialMonitorSetting.DATA_TYPE]].labelValue;
}
getBaudRate(): BaudRateSetting{
return this.baudRate[this.selectionIndex[SerialMonitorSetting.BAUD_RATE]].labelValue;
}
getOutpuView(): ViewSetting{
return this.outputView[this.selectionIndex[SerialMonitorSetting.VIEW]].labelValue
}
getSerialPortFilters(): SerialPortFilter[]{
return this.serialPortFilters;
}
setSetting(setting: SerialMonitorSetting, value: string){
let values = this.settingsOptions[setting].map( elem => elem.labelValue )
if (values.includes(value)){
this.selectionIndex[setting] = values.indexOf(value);
} else {
throw new InvalidArugmentError("Not a valid setting", `one of ${JSON.stringify(this.settingsOptions)}`)
}
}
setDisplayType(value: string){
this.setSetting(SerialMonitorSetting.DISPLAY_TYPE, value)
}
setDataType(value: string){
this.setSetting(SerialMonitorSetting.DATA_TYPE, value)
}
setBaudRate(value: string){
this.setSetting(SerialMonitorSetting.BAUD_RATE, value)
}
setOutputView(value: string){
this.setSetting(SerialMonitorSetting.VIEW, value)
}
setSerialPortFilters(filters: SerialPortFilter[]){
this.serialPortFilters = filters
}
}
export default SerialMonitorConfig
export { SerialMonitorSetting, SerialMonitorConfig, DisplayTypeSetting, DataTypeSetting, BaudRateSetting, ViewSetting }
